"Planisphere and Starfinder" is your personal guide to exploring the night sky. It goes beyond the mystery of astronomy and introduces basic techniques for star observation, making it easier to find and recognize objects. Starting with our solar system, it shows how to observe the Moon, planets, comets, and asteroids, as well as how to take advantage of events such as eclipses and meteor showers. Then, you'll travel to constellations with a guide to the constellations. Each entry is accompanied by a clear star map, showing where you can see the constellation in the world and even explaining the symbolic significance of its star formation. The final section guides you month by month through the night sky so you don't miss a thing. The book also contains a detachable planisphere that you can take anywhere, showing the entire sky overhead, at any time of the night and any season of the year.
